Ceria nanoparticles alleviate myocardial ischemia-reperfusion injury by inhibiting cardiomyocyte apoptosis via alleviating ROS mediated excessive mitochondrial fission

Reperfusion through thrombolytic therapy or primary percutaneous coronary intervention is commonly used to deal with acute myocardial infarction.
